Synopsis "Shark Trail: The Complete Adventures of Bellow Bill Williams, Volume 3"

Finally in book form: the burly pearler-Bellow Bill Williams-was one of the most popular, and colorful, characters who appeared in the early 1930s issues of Argosy. Written by Ralph R. Perry, Bellow Bill was a seemingly-superhuman, tattoo-covered mountain of a sailor who couldn't keep from stumbling into one adventure after another throughout the South Seas. Clearly another inspiration for the creation of Doc Savage (whose creator Lester Dent was an avid reader of Argosy during this period), these adventures of Bellow Bill have never before been reprinted. Included here are his final eight stories, originally appearing in 1934-36: "The Scar," "The Jungle Master," "Blood Payment," "The Rats of Mahia," "Fangs of the Fetish," "The Golden Oyster," "The Atoll of Flaming Men," and "Shark Trail."
